Abstract
In a method of automating the loading and unloading of container ships in container terminals, a stowage plan of a ship cargo compartment to be handled by a container crane is transmitted from a harbor-side master computer via a data link to a PC of a crane automation system which renders the container crane operative in response to the stowage plan for transporting containers between a container ship and a repository location in a container storage area of the container terminal. The stowage plan is displayed on a touch screen of the crane automation system, whereby a next following repository location to be handled in the stowage plan is indicated on the touch screen, e.g. through a change in color.

11. A crane automation system for a container crane for transporting containers between container ships and an on-shore side of a container terminal for loading and unloading container ships, comprising:
-
a harbor-side master computer;
a PC operatively connected to the master computer via a data link to receive a stowage plan of the cargo compartment of a container ship to be handled by the container crane; and
a touch screen for displaying the stowage plan transmitted to the PC, said touch screen being constructed to indicate a next following repository location to be handled in the stowage plan. - View Dependent Claims (13, 14, 15, 16, 17, 18, 19, 20, 21)
